افزونه رفع باگ وردپرس موضوعی است که تمام افرادی که با مدیریت یک سایت وردپرسی سرو کار دارند باید با آن آشنا باشند.
این افزونه ها امنیت سایت را افزایش می دهد و از بسیاری از مشکلاتی که ممکن است به دلیل وجود باگ در سایت ایجاد شود جلوگیری می کند.
برای مثال یکی از مشکلات رایج،مشکل عدم نمایش ادیتور وردپرس است.
افزونه های مختلفی امروزه به منظور رفع باگ ایجاد شده اند که کار کردن با اغلب آن ها بسیار ساده است و به دلیل محیط کاربری بدون جزئیات آن ها توسط تمام افراد قابل استفاده می باشند.
در صورتی که به دنبال یک افزونه رفع باگ وردپرس مناسب و با کیفیت هستید و هنوز به مورد خوبی دست پیدا نکرده اید به شما پیشنهاد می کنیم تا انتهای این مقاله همراه باشید.
در ادامه به سوالات زیر پاسخ خواهیم داد:
- باگ وردپرس چیست و در چه شرایطی بروز می کند؟
- چه اقداماتی بیش از همه در به وجود آمدن باگ های وردپرس تاثیرگذار می باشند؟
- به منظور رفع باگ های وردپرس چه اقداماتی باید انجام داد؟
- در انتخاب افزونه رفع باگ وردپرس چه نکاتی باید مد نظر قرار گیرند؟
- افزونه رفع باگ وردپرس hotfix چیست و به چه صورت عمل می کند؟
- در صورت عدم استفاده از افزونه رفع باگ وردپرس چه مشکلاتی در سایت ایجاد می شود؟
باگ وردپرس چیست و در چه شرایطی بروز می کند؟
برای تمام ما پیش آمده که هنگام مطالعه مطالب یک سایت به طور ناگهانی از صفحه خارج شویم، یا زمانی که قصد ورود به یک لینک را داریم نتوانیم به راحتی به آن دسترسی داشته باشیم. اختلالاتی اینچنینی که موجب عملکرد صحیح سایت ها می شود باگ نامیده می شود که در ادامه به طور مفصل در مورد چگونگی ایجاد باگ و رفع آن صحبت خواهیم کرد.
باگ چیست
خطاهای کوچک که می توانند در عملکرد یک سایت ایجاد مشکل کنند باگ نامیده می شوند که برای نخستین بار در اواسط دهه 90 میلادی توسط گریس هاپر در زمان عیب یابی یک دستگاه ماشین حساب مطرح شد. باگ ها انواع مختلفی دارند و گاهی فهمیدن ایجاد آن ها به هیچ وجه ساده نیست و نیاز به مدت ها زمان برای عیب یابی و پیدا کردن باگ می باشد.
باگ وردپرس ممکن است در زمینه امنیت این سایت ایجاد شود یا دسترسی کاربران به بخش های مختلف سایت را مختل کرده و حتی موجب کند شدن بارگیری صفحه شود. برای اینکه فرآیند رفع باگ با سرعت مناسب و به درستی انجام شود، نیاز به پیدا کردن باگ و علت بروز آن است.
علل بروز باگ در وردپرس
آشنایی با علل بروز باگ ها، بیش از هرچیز به ریشه یابی باگ کمک می کند تا رفع آن به ساده ترین شکل ممکن میسر باشد. مسائل مختلفی وجود دارد که ممکن است باعث بروز باگ در یک سایت وردپرسی شود، از جمله این مسائل می توان عدم انطباق بروزرسانی ها را اشاره کرد،
برای درک بهتر این مسئله می توان این مورد را مثال زد، زمانی که کاربر سیستم وردپرس را به نسخه های جدید بروزرسانی کرده اما پوسته ها و افزونه های خود را در نسخه های قبلی نگه می دارد، عدم انطباق نسخه سیستم با افزونه ها ممکن است باعث مشکل در خواندن افزونه شده و در نتیجه در عملکرد کلی سایت تاثیر داشته باشد. همچنین استفاده از افزونه های غیر معتبر، کد نویسی بدون تسلط به این کار و… نیز می توانند در ایجاد باگ وردپرس نقش داشته باشند.
پیشنهاد می کنیم از پست مشکل پیوندهای یکتا وردپرس دیدن کنید.
چه اقداماتی بیش از همه در به وجود آمدن باگ های وردپرس تاثیرگذار می باشند؟
از زمان روی کار آمدن سیستم مدیریت محتوای وردپرس، مدیریت سایت های اینترنتی ساده تر از گذشته شد و بسیاری از افرادی که با علم کد نویسی و برنامه نویسی نیز آشنایی نداشتند توانستند سایت هایی مطابق با نیاز خود را مدیریت کنند. علی رغم سادگی مدیریت محتواها با وردپرس، برخی مسائل مهم نیز وجود دارند که عدم دقت به آن ها می تواند باعث بروز باگ شده و باگ های کوچک نیز ممکن است به مشکلات جدی، حتی از دست رفتن سایت منجر شوند.
دیتابیس نامناسب
یکی از اقداماتی که ممکن است موجب بروز باگ در وردپرس شود استفاده از دیتابیس نامناسب است، برای بارگیری سایت در هر زمان نیاز است که اطلاعات در یک دیتابیس ذخیره شوند تا کاربران در هر ساعت شبانه روز که به سایت مراجعه کردند اطلاعات از دیتابیس دریافت شده و در سیستم آن ها نمایش داده شود، برای سایت های وردپرسی دیتابیس های مختلفی وجود دارند که انتخاب نوع ناامن و عدم توجه به اطلاعات ذخیره شده در آن می تواند باعث بروز باگ در سایت شود.
عدم آپدیت افزونه هاو…
دیگر علت بروز باگ های وردپرسی عدم آپدیت به موقع افزونه هاست. برخی از افزونه ها که به طور آپدیتی ندارند و از عرضه خارج شده اند باید با افزونه های جدید جایگزین شوند تا مطابق با بروزرسانی های سیستم افزونه نیز بروزرسانی شده و برای استفاده در وردپرس قابل کاربرد باشد.
نه تنها افزونه ها، بلکه قالب و هرچیز دیگری که در وردپرس استفاده می شود باید به موقع آپدیت شود. البته برخی آپدیت ها خود دارای باگ می باشند که در این صورت، سیستم ارائه دهنده آن ها بلافاصله آپدیت بدون خطا را منتشر می کند.
دریافت افزونه ها از مراجع نامعتبر
برخی افراد برای کاهش هزینه ها افزونه های مورد نظر یا قالب های سایت را از مراجع نامعتبر خریداری می کنند که این کار نیز می تواند موجب بروز باگ در وردپرس به دلیل اختلالات افزونه شود. افزونه هایی که در مراکز معتبر عرضه می شوند به دلیل حجم بیشتر دریافت ها، زودتر از باگ احتمالی مطلع شده و در صدد رفع آن عمل می کنند.
عدم بررسی دوره ای سایت
هر سایت وردپرسی باید در بازه های زمانی مختلف بررسی شود تا در صورت وجود هر حفره امنیتی یا عدم تطابق در نسخه افزونه ها با نرم افزار و… اقدامات لازم برای رفع مشکل به موقع انجام شود. در غیر اینصورت یک حفره امنیتی کوچک می تواند محلی برای نفوذ مخرب ها به سایت شده و حتی موجب از دست رفتن کل اطلاعات موجود در سایت و از بین رفتن آن شود.
به منظور رفع باگ های وردپرس چه اقداماتی باید انجام داد؟
برای رفع باگ وردپرس نیاز به یک سری اقدامات است که باید به طور دقیق و مرحله به مرحله انجام گیرند. بهتر است این اقدامات توسط اشخاص حرفه ای و مسلط به سیستم وردپرس انجام شوند تا عیب یابی باگ سریع تر انجام شده و اقدامات لازم برای رفع آن نیز با دقت بالاتری انجام گردند. در این بخش برخی از مراحل کلی که در صورت مشاهده باگ در وردپرس باید طی شوند توضیح داده شده اند.
بررسی وردپرس
اولین مرحله برای رفع باگ وردپرس بررسی کلی نرم افزار است. در این بررسی نرم افزار اصلی، قالب ها، افزونه ها، دیتابیس و هر آنچه که به سایت شما مربوط بوده و در ارتباط مستقیم یا غیر مستقیم است باید مورد توجه قرار گیرد.
دسته بندی مشکل
بعد از بررسی و پیدا کردن قسمت هایی که احتمال بروز باگ در آن ها وجود دارد نیاز است که مشکل دسته بندی شود. به عنوان مثال در صورتی که احتمال بروز خطا در چند قسمت مشاهده شد باید هر کدام را بسته به شدت احتمال و نوع باگ دسته بندی کرد تا در ادامه، رفع آن راحت تر انجام گردد.
یافتن علت بروز
در مرحله بعدی مطابق با دسته بندی و اولویت هایی که انجام شد باید علت بروز خطا و مشکلات هر قسمت را بررسی کرد. به عنوان مثال در صورتی که باگ از قالب وردپرس تشخیص داده شده باشد ممکن است به علت عدم بروزرسانی بوده یا تغییر نادرست در کدنویسی موجب آن شده باشد، که با بررسی کامل قالب می توان آن را تشخیص داد.
رفع
در آخرین مرحله و بعد از پیدا کردن علت بروز باید تک به تک در جهت رفع باگ ها تلاش کرد. گاهی اوقات باگ در عملکرد کلی سایت اثر منفی نمی گذارد اما می تواند سایت را نسبت به هکرها ضعیف کند که در این صورت با بررسی به موقع وردپرس می توان از آن جلوگیری کرد. بسته به میزان تسلط و نوع باگ، رفع آن هم به صورت دستی و هم با استفاده از افزونه ها امکان پذیر می باشد.
در انتخاب افزونه رفع باگ وردپرس چه نکاتی باید مد نظر قرار گیرند؟
در انتهای بخش قبل گفته شد که یکی از راه های ساده برای پیدا کردن باگ وردپرس و برطرف کردن آن استفاده از افزونه رفع باگ وردپرس، این افزونه ها که بسته به نوع باگ انواع مختلفی داشته و برخی در مورد باگ های زیادی قابل استفاده می باشند را می توان در سایت های مختلف پیدا کرد. با این حال، برای سادگی جستجو بهتر است نکاتی را در انتخاب افزونه رفع باگ وردپرس مد نظر قرار داد.
نوع باگ
اولین و مهم ترین مسئله ای که در مورد انتخاب افزونه رفع باگ وردپرس باید به آن توجه کرد، نوع باگ است. باگ های مختلف روش های متفاوتی برای برطرف کردن دارند و اغلب افزونه ها تنها برای رفع عیب یک باگ کاربرد دارند، به همین دلیل به خصوص در مورد افزونه هایی که باید خریداری شوند نیاز است که ابتدا نوع باگ به درستی شناسایی شود.
اعتبار مرکز دریافت افزونه
مرکز یا سایتی که افزونه از ان دریافت و خریداری می شود نیز در انتخاب افزونه رفع باگ وردپرس موثر است. سایت خرید افزونه باید از اعتبار کافی برخوردار باشد و افزونه ها را بدون خطا و با پشتیبانی به کاربران عرضه کند تا در صورت بروز هرگونه مشکل، کاربر با پشتیبانی مرکز خرید ارتباط داشته باشد.
ویژگی های افزونه
در نهایت باید به ویژگی های افزونه رفع باگ وردپرس در انتخاب دقت کرد. برخی افزونه ها برای انواع مختلفی از باگ ها که منشا یکسان داشته باشند کاربرد داشته اما برخی افزونه ها تنها یک باگ اختصاصی را برطرف می کنند. همچنین محیط کاربری این افزونه ها باید ساده باشد که این مسئله نیز در انتخاب تاثیرگذار می باشد.
افزونه رفع باگ وردپرس hotfix چیست و به چه صورت عمل می کند؟
همان طور که گفته شد برای رفع باگ وردپرس افزونه های مختلفی وجود دارند که از جمله آن ها می توان به hotfix، Deactivate Plugins Per Page و… اشاره کرد، که در میان آن ها hotfix کاربردی تر بوده و در سطح وسیع تری عمل می کند.
افزونه hotfix و کار با آن
این افزونه با شناسایی باگ های امنیتی سایت و برطرف کردن آن ها، علاوه بر افزایش امنیت سایت مشکلات مختلفی که در اثر وجود این باگ ها مانند کند شدن بارگیری صفحه و… به وجود می آید را نیز برطرف می کند.
کار کردن با افزونه رفع باگ وردپرس hotfix بسیار ساده است. این افزونه بلافاصله بعد از نصب و راه اندازی شروع به فعالیت می کند و نیاز به اقدام و تنظیم خاصی در آن نیست.
بعد از بررسی کامل بخش های مختلف سایت و پیدا کردن باگ ها و کدهای مخرب، افزونه پیشنهاد رفع آن ها را به کاربر می دهد که با تایید این مسئله، به طور خودکار شروع به برطرف کردن آن ها می کند.
البته این افزونه برای باگ هایی کاربرد دارد که اختلال چندانی در سایت ایجاد نکرده و سیستم به طور دوره ای توسط مدیر بررسی می گردد. نکته مهم در مورد این افزونه هماهنگی نسخه وردپرس با این افزونه می باشد.
در صورت عدم استفاده از افزونه رفع باگ وردپرس چه مشکلاتی در سایت ایجاد می شود؟
با توجه به اینکه در سیستم وردپرس معمولا کدنویسی به میزان کمتری انجام می شود، مشکلات و باگ هایی که در سایت های سفارشی ایجاد می شوند در این سیستم رخ نخواهد داد با این حال این سیستم نیز ممکن است در اثر عدم به روزرسانی یا استفاده از افزونه های نامعتبر دچار باگ و مشکلاتی شود که برطرف کردن به موقع آن ها الزامی می باشد.
در صورتی که مدیر سایت بدون در نظر گرفتن این موضوع بررسی های دوره ای سایت را به موقع انجام نداده یا از افزونه رفع باگ وردپرس برای پیدا کردن به موقع باگ ها استفاده نکند ممکن است ابتدا مشکلاتی در بارگذاری سایت برای کاربران ایجاد شود که موجب نارضایتی آن ها و تاثیر در سئو می شود، در نهایت افزایش باگ های سایت در مواردی به نابودی سایت منجر می شود.
نوشته افزونه رفع باگ وردپرس اولین بار در آیلین وب. پدیدار شد.
0 Commentaires